- Ease of use: Shopify's intuitive interface makes setting up and managing your store a breeze. You don't need any coding knowledge to get started!
- Customization options: With tons of themes and apps, you can personalize your store to match your brand's unique identity. Shopify's App Store is a treasure trove of tools that add functionality to your store, from marketing and sales to customer service and inventory management.
- Payment gateway integration: Shopify integrates with popular payment gateways in India, like Razorpay and PayU, making it easy for your customers to pay.
- Scalability: Shopify can handle businesses of all sizes, from small startups to large enterprises. As your business grows, Shopify grows with you!
- Marketing tools: Shopify provides built-in tools for SEO, email marketing, and social media integration to help you promote your products.
- Open-source and free: The WooCommerce plugin itself is free to download and use. This makes it a cost-effective option, especially for budget-conscious entrepreneurs.
- Highly customizable: WooCommerce allows you to customize almost every aspect of your store, from the design to the functionality.
- Integration with WordPress: If you're already familiar with WordPress, using WooCommerce will feel natural and easy. You can manage your website content and your online store from the same dashboard.
- Extensive plugin library: The WooCommerce ecosystem is massive, with tons of plugins that add features like advanced product variations, subscription options, and more.
- SEO-friendly: WordPress is known for its excellent SEO capabilities, and WooCommerce inherits those benefits.
- Scalability: BigCommerce is built to handle businesses of all sizes, with a focus on supporting high-volume stores.
- Built-in features: BigCommerce offers a wide range of built-in features, including SEO tools, marketing integrations, and advanced product options.
- Multi-channel selling: BigCommerce allows you to sell on multiple channels, such as your website, social media, and marketplaces like Amazon and eBay.
- SEO-friendly: BigCommerce is optimized for search engines, helping you improve your store's visibility in search results.
- Security: BigCommerce handles all the security aspects of your store, so you don't have to worry about it.
- Ease of use: Wix's drag-and-drop interface makes it super simple to design and customize your online store.
- Templates and design options: Wix offers a wide variety of professionally designed templates to get you started.
- Built-in features: Wix provides essential e-commerce features, such as product management, payment gateway integration, and shipping options.
- Marketing tools: Wix offers basic marketing tools to help you promote your products.
- Focus on Indian market: Instamojo is tailored to the Indian market, supporting popular payment gateways and offering features specific to Indian businesses.
- Ease of use: Setting up your online store on Instamojo is incredibly simple and takes very little time.
- Digital product support: Instamojo is well-suited for selling digital products like ebooks, online courses, and software.
- Payment gateway integration: Instamojo integrates with popular payment gateways in India, making it easy to accept payments.
- Free plan available: Instamojo offers a free plan with basic features, making it a budget-friendly option for startups.

WooCommerce
WooCommerce isn't a standalone platform; it's a plugin that turns your existing WordPress website into an e-commerce store. This is awesome if you already have a WordPress site, as it allows you to leverage the flexibility and customization options that WordPress offers. Here's what makes WooCommerce stand out:
Who is WooCommerce best for?
WooCommerce is a great option for businesses that already have a WordPress website or those who want a highly customizable and cost-effective e-commerce solution. It's perfect for entrepreneurs who are comfortable with WordPress and want full control over their store's design and functionality. If you're tech-savvy or have someone on your team who is, WooCommerce can be a powerful choice. However, keep in mind that you'll need to handle your own hosting, security, and maintenance, which might require some technical know-how.

Instamojo
Instamojo is a popular platform specifically designed for Indian businesses, and it's perfect for entrepreneurs selling digital products or offering services. It's incredibly easy to set up and start selling, making it a great option for those who want a simple and hassle-free experience. Here's what makes Instamojo stand out:
Who is Instamojo best for?
Instamojo is an excellent choice for Indian businesses, especially those selling digital products or offering services. It's perfect for entrepreneurs who want a simple and easy-to-use platform with a focus on the Indian market. If you're a solopreneur or a small business owner looking for a quick and easy way to start selling online, Instamojo is a great option to consider.
